Morph eXchange

  • Users Manager modification. The Users Manager user type has been modified to remove rights over the Account Admin user type. Thus, the Users Manager can add, modify, and remove all other users except for the Account Admin user type. This addresses the issue that a user with the Users Manager role can create for himself an Account Admin user type and elevate his rights.
  • Enhancements to Sign up and add user forms. The Morph eXchange registration and add-user forms have been enhanced with a username-checking feature, to determine if a username input is already in use or is still available. We have also applied realtime error-checking for the password field, to ensure it follows the required format. The error notifications print dynamically without the user pressing the submit button. The same dynamic error-reporting is applied to the confirm password field and the email field.

Morph Application Platform
  • Tripled Bandwidth. Developers can now enjoy triple the bandwidth that we initially offered. See the Morph Application Platform information page for details.
  • Production Log. Developers can now directly inspect their application's production logs. In the settings page of your AppSpace subscription, click on Prod Logs and select the compute instance whose production log you want to view.
  • Rake Tasks. You may now run rake tasks right on your AppSpace. While in the settings page of your AppSpace, click on Rake Tasks. Select the rake task you want to execute and input arguments if necessary. Click Submit and watch your rake task go.
  • Retired AppSpace Sizes. We can now retire AppSpace sizes. When a size is retired, it will no longer be visible from the sizes drop-down field although existing AppSpaces that are already using it will continue to run under that size. We recommend switching to the next possible size when you find that the size you're using has already been retired.
  • Reserved Subdomains. Previously, when an AppSpace subscription is created, the subdomain assigned to it will redirect to the Morph eXchange homepage if the application is not yet active. We've changed this behavior so that subdomain will now show that it's been reserved for a particular AppSpace subscription.
  • Redirected Domains. Redirected domains, from the start, are only available to paid AppSpace subscriptions. However, we've been making this field available even if the AppSpace subscription is free. This has been confusing for developers on the free plan. We've changed it now so that the field is only visible in subscriptions that have a base price.
  • Change AppSpace sizes without stopping the process. Previously, developers had to stop their application's process before they can switch over to another size. We've changed this so that you won't have to. Change the size anytime you like and we'll take care of the rest!
  • Ruport gem. Ruport 1.6.0 and its dependencies are now available in our servers. Specifically, the following gems were installed along with Ruport: fastercsv-1.2.3, archive-tar-minitar-0.5.2, color-1.4.0, transaction-simple-1.4.0, pdf-writer-1.1.8.
